What does superfluity in this sentence mean? So I have read this sentence in Cambridge dictionary, fascinated by it but I don't quite understand what it actually means. Hope somebody can enlighten me, thank you! She was depressed by a sense of her own superfluity

"She was depressed by a sense of her own superfluity" In this context, I think it means she was depressed because she thought she was unnecessary or worthless. Superfluity doesn't have to have a negative connotation or meaning, but here there is a negativity to it.
